King Hussein of Jordan JY1
In memory of his Majesty King Hussein I of Jordan - sk (Feb. 8th, 1999).
King Hussein was highly regarded by all the radio amateurs around the world.
A QSO with JY1 was considered by many hams to be both an honor and a privilege.
On June 20th, 1991 I met King Hussein of Jordan. We had a wonderful rag-chew
qso together. At that time he was at home in Amman.
Andaman & Nicobar Islands
The Andaman & Nicobar Islands are located at the Bay of Bengal between Lon 92- 94 deg
east and Lat 6 - 14 deg north. There are 572 Islands, Islets and Rocks in the
south eastern part of the Bay of Bengal. The highest points of the Islands are Saddle Peak
(732 m)/Andaman Islands and Mount Thuillier(642m)/Nicobar Islands.
The Islands were in the past inaccessible and caused mistery during centuries.
Todays tourists are impressed by the beauty of the Islands with the white beaches and
palme trees which sway to the rythm of the Sea.
Macquarie Island
Where is Macquarie Island ?
Macquarie Island (34 km long x 5 km wide) is an oceanic island in the Southern
Ocean, lying 1,500 km south-east of Tasmania and approximately halfway between Australia
and the Antarctic continent. The island is the exposed crest of the undersea Macquarie
Ridge, raised to its present position where the Indo-Australian tectonic plate meets
the Pacific plate. It is a site of major geoconservation significance, being the only
place on earth where rocks from the earth's mantle (6 km below the ocean floor) are being
actively exposed above sea-level. These unique exposures include excellent examples of pillow
basalts and other extrusive rocks.
